>> Only minor improvements were required -- mostly to correct line types (the
>> hidden wall was actually a border, the inner pillar should have -outline
>> in option...). All my changes are marked red in the enclosed picture.


Now that I've drawn about 8km of survey the last scrap (top right hand
corner - scrap bmb3_s3) has had 'pillar failure' again.

There are 3 pillars which do not work (the insides are filled). They are all
walls with -outline in and I've tried reversing them, but it seems to stay
broken. What's going on?
